Understanding Box Type Substations: Key Features and Benefits
Box Type Substations play a crucial role in modern electrical distribution systems. Specifically designed for compactness and efficiency, these substations provide a seamless integration of power transmission and transformation functionalities in a single unit. Their modular design allows for easy installation and maintenance, making them ideal for urban environments where space is often limited.

Understanding Low Voltage Reactive Power Compensation Cabinets: Enhancing Efficiency in Electrical Systems
Low voltage reactive power compensation cabinets are essential components in modern electrical systems, particularly in the field of power generation. Their primary function is to manage reactive power, which is a crucial aspect of electrical energy that does not perform any work but is necessary for maintaining voltage levels within the power system.
